    Trent N.

    The most hyped restaurant on the Internet for Chicago absolutely lives up to the hype. Reservations are posted 21 days in advance on Resy at 9am Central Standard Time. These reservations literally don't last 5 seconds. My sister and I were online trying to get reservations and luckily she was able to get 9pm. The best I could do on fastest finger was 10pm. [[HIGHLIGHT]]When arriving at the restaurant it looks like a speakeasy inside.[[ENDHIGHLIGHT]] There is a hostess stand immediately to the right, and then another right. However, there is a second hostess that is standing in the doorway when you walk in with an iPad that can also check you in. After being checked in we waited about 10 minutes for our table to be ready. Once it was ready the hostess walked us through the restaurant all the way to the back, and then down the stairs into the parlor. [[HIGHLIGHT]]It is super dark down there. So dark you are going to need your phone to see the menu and things around you[[ENDHIGHLIGHT]]. Shout out to our server Zane as he was a top tier A+ server! All of his recommendations from not ordering a full loaf of bread to steaks to sides were spot on. Up first was the worst item of the night, the $17.95 Mezcal Corpse Reviver cocktail. I wanted a cocktail with mezcal as I like the burnt smoky taste, but this one wasn't it. I really enjoyed my $14 Corazon Cocktail (Dirty Martini). They served it with the 3 blue cheese olives just how I like it. Up first, we had the $6.49 Hand-Made Sourdough bread. This was spot on perfect. We got the smaller order and it was plenty big enough for 2 people, unless you plan on ruining your dinner. Then, we got a $13.99 1/2 wedge salad. Perfectly made wedge salad. I got the $15.99 brussels sprouts and they were exquisite. If they were slightly more charred they would have been perfect. The taste, glaze, and toppings were perfect. I also got an order of the $15.99 button mushrooms. They were very very good as well. For the main course, I had the $89.99 bone in filet mignon. I am a tough steak critic, and this was one of the best steaks I've ever had anywhere. A little plain, and lightly salted, but it was a perfect juicy medium. For dessert we had the $15.99 carrot cake. I did not like this carrot cake as well as Flemings or J Alexanders, but it was certainly very good. The entire meal was over $350, but it was a dang good meal. This is clearly a restaurant you come to on a special occasion. The staff, the experience, and the food certainly were very special. If you want to spend a bunch of money on top tier food in Chicago, then this is your spot.

    Tray

    [[HIGHLIGHT]]The vibes were amazing. Dim lighting, moody music, brick walls, and one of the better date night atmospheres in Chicago. 9.5/10.[[ENDHIGHLIGHT]] Service was amazing. Our server was making jokes, memorized our entire order, and made the experience feel special. 9.5/10. The burger is absolutely worth the hype. The bacon is a MUST. Without it, it's a normal burger. With it, it's one of the best burgers I've ever had. Juicy, high quality, and not nearly as heavy as Au Cheval's. 9.7/10. The smoked salmon Caesar was great, but it doesn't really taste like a traditional Caesar. A little soggy, but still enjoyable. 8/10. The truffle mac was heavenly. Loved the creaminess and crust on top. A little softer than I prefer, and the truffle flavor was on the lighter side, but it worked really well. 9/10. The ribeye was cooked perfectly medium rare with a great peppercorn crust. I'm not a huge steak person, but it tasted like a really high-quality steak. The steak salt and béarnaise sauce definitely elevated it. 9/10. The fried chicken was amazing. Super crispy, juicy meat, flavorful seasoning, and the mashed potatoes and gravy paired perfectly. Hard to believe it's only around $30 for four huge pieces. 9/10. They surprised us with ice cream and hot fudge for our celebration, and the fudge was sooo good. 8/10. Overall, great food, amazing service, and one of the best date night vibes in Chicago.

    Other than the way it's cut and the size, is there a difference between the chicago cut 16oz ribeye vs. the 10oz ribeye frites?

    Nah not really. Definitely get the Chicago cut. Or even better, the 22oz dry aged one. That one is insane and aged for 46 days

    There are two prices listed next to each salad on their dinner menu. I'm assuming the more expensive option is for the purpose of ordering a salad as an entree? Or is it just to share? Can someone confirm?

    It's small or large. Small is shared for 2 as a side/app. Large cab be shared by 3-4 as a side. Small can be sized for an entree, especially with their sourdough bread. If you are going carb/gluten free, small may not be enough for an entree
